  • Tax Center volunteers needed at Scott AFB

    The Scott AFB Tax Center needs volunteers to join its staff for the upcoming tax season. Volunteers can be active duty, family members, or retirees. They will assist taxpayers, prepare and file returns, answer basic tax questions, or assist with general office duties such as answering the telephone.
